Chinese Slang 101: "Gǒupìbùtōng"

When you hear someone talking something that is completely nonsense, it is time to use "Gǒupìbùtōng". "Gǒupìbùtōng" means "dog fart" in Chinese. When you hear someone lying to you, you can also use "Gǒupìbùtōng".

Example:

A: I lost my phone last night and... I...uh... went out to look for it...uh... the whole night!
B: That is just "Gǒupìbùtōng"!
